Un utente ha chiesto
Categoria: MC4WP: Mailchimp for WordPress di WordPress
Domanda: Errore API Mailchimp: metodo 405 non consentito. Questo membro dell’elenco non può essere eliminato.
Si è verificato un problema con il plug-in quando si contatta l’API Mailchimp. ottengo un sacco di:
[2019-06-30 20:31:35] ERROR: Form 29 > Mailchimp API error: 405 Method Not Allowed. This list member cannot be removed. Please contact support.
Request: DELETE https://us20.api.mailchimp.com/3.0/lists/de4ac6f42b/members/a1ef5c140136a9c8099e90b956885e89
Response: 405 Method Not Allowed - {"type":"http://developer.mailchimp.com/documentation/mailchimp/guides/error-glossary/","title":"Method Not Allowed","status":405,"detail":"This list member cannot be removed. Please contact support.","instance":"46b1adc5-8121-4301-b591-4dfac73401dd"}
Ho notato che questo accade a me quando provo a iscrivermi quando ho già un’e-mail di conferma che ho ignorato, ma succede anche ad altri abbonati per la prima volta.
Perché il plugin cerca comunque di eliminare gli utenti?
La pagina per cui ho bisogno di aiuto: [log in to see the link]
-
Collaboratore plugin
(@hchouhan)
Buongiorno,
Ho appena provato utilizzando la mia e-mail personale “me @ harish… ..com” e ha funzionato. Ricevi questo messaggio durante il tuo test o quando un cliente si iscrive?
(@ martin3361)
Buongiorno,
Non sto dicendo che non funzioni, funziona la maggior parte del tempo, ma ci sono casi che mi danno fastidio che potrei perdere abbonati.Ecco un esempio di un caso del genere
Ecco alcuni passaggi che ho notato che lo fanno accadere:
1.si prega di annullare l’iscrizione prima
2.quindi iscriviti, ma non rispondere all’e-mail di conferma (come se fosse spam o qualcosa del genere)Potrebbe essere necessario ripetere il secondo passaggio più volte e verrà visualizzato l’errore.
Nell’esempio dello screenshot, non c’era nemmeno un’e-mail di conferma (né nello spam né altrove)
grazie
(@iopodx)
Caro Martino,
Caro Harish,stiamo affrontando esattamente lo stesso problema. Per quanto riguarda la fonte, provi a annullare l’iscrizione che fallisce dando l’errore 405. Non sono sicuro che si tratti di un problema di MailChimp o di un errore del plug-in.
// if status is "pending", delete & then re-subscribe // this ensures that a new double opt-in email is send out $this->get_api()->delete_list_member( $list_id, $email_address );
-> non riesce
Passaggi per riprodurre:
Iscriviti alla newsletter ma ignora il double opt-in. Riprova (forse qualche giorno dopo).(@ martin3361)
Il problema è che l’API viene chiamata con il metodo GET
La cancellazione dell’utente dovrebbe essere il metodo DELETE, riferimento rapido all’API Mailchimp:
DELETE / liste / {list_id} / membri / {subscriber_hash} Rimuovi un membro dalla lista
quindi il metodo 405 non è consentito
Risolvilo, per favore. grazie
(@ martin3361)
@hchouhan Ciao, qualche informazione o un controllo su questo?
grazie
Collaboratore plugin
(@hchouhan)
@martin3361 @iopodx,
Si prega di condividere maggiori dettagli. Alcuni altri clienti hanno segnalato questo problema. Presumo che MailChimp.com abbia cambiato qualcosa nella sua API che lo sta causando. Esamineremo la questione, ma a causa della complessità del problema, ti preghiamo di darci un po’ di tempo per rispondere.
(@ctdmichel)
Ho lo stesso problema con le persone che cercano di iscriversi alla mia mailing list. Non capisco tutto quello che sta dicendo il giornale, ma sembra che stia cercando di rimuovere gli abbonati che è l’esatto contrario di quello che voglio. Si prega di aiutare al più presto!
(@ ttm2)
anche io ho lo stesso problema! Nessun progresso?
Collaboratore plugin
(@hchouhan)
Buongiorno,
Per ora, come soluzione temporanea, ti consigliamo di disabilitare il “Double Opt-in”. Lo stiamo ancora esaminando e ci vorrà del tempo.
(@sabbioso1969)
Qualche aggiornamento in merito?
Collaboratore plugin
(@hchouhan)
Buongiorno,
Tieni presente che si tratta di un problema complesso che riguarda anche MailChimp.com (che non controlliamo) che richiederebbe più tempo per essere risolto.
(@riseandseekco)
Ho ancora questo problema e il mio sito ha bisogno di un doppio opt-in, quindi non è davvero una soluzione per disattivarlo. Qualche altro consiglio?
Collaboratore plugin
(@hchouhan)
Buongiorno,
Mi dispiace dire che non abbiamo altri suggerimenti in questo momento. Stiamo utilizzando l’API MailChimp e anche i loro moduli stanno riscontrando questo problema, quindi ci vorrebbe più tempo per trovare una soluzione a questo problema.
Collaboratore plugin
(@hchouhan)
Buongiorno,
Abbiamo appena rilasciato un aggiornamento per risolvere questo problema. Puoi aggiornare il tuo plugin e riprovare?
(@ amireza20)
caro amico e maestro
grazie mille per la tua azione
il nostro problema risolto con l’aggiornamento alla nuova versione di mailchimp
Gli iraniani ti amano Harish Chouhan
Hai risolto il tuo problema?
0 / 0